OREANDA-NEWS. National Rating Agency has withdrawn its credit rating on RRC Business Telecommunications Ltd. (Cyprus) due to the contract expiry. The company has been assigned an ‘A+’ national scale and an ‘iBB’ global scale exit ratings. The ‘А+’ national scale and ‘iBB’ global scale credit ratings were originally assigned on October 10, 2014.

RRC Business Telecommunications Limited (Cyprus) was founded in 1992. It is the principal company in RRC Group, which is a distributor of high tech, with offices in Russia, the Czech Republic, Hungary, Poland, Serbia, Slovenia, Kazakhstan, Romania, Croatia, as well as representative offices in Azerbaijan, Uzbekistan, and Belarus. The company has 4 divisions: RRC Infrastructure – servers, data storage systems and uninterruptible power supplies; RRC Networking – network equipment and IP-technologies; RRC Security – information security; RRC Identification – automatic data identification and speed printing. RRC Business Telecommunications Limited is a vertically integrated holding company; one of its shareholders is the founder of RRC Group – Konstantin Sidorov.
